Application for approval of the KBMS / AMOU & MUA (Masters & General Purpose Hands) Enterprise Agreement 2014.

[1] An application has been made for approval of an enterprise agreement known as the KBMS / AMOU & MUA (Masters & General Purpose Hands) Enterprise Agreement 2014 (the Agreement). The application was made pursuant to s.185 of the Fair Work Act 2009 (the Act). It has been made by King Bay Marine Services Pty Ltd. The agreement is a single enterprise agreement.

[2] On the basis of the material contained in the application and accompanying statutory declaration, I am satisfied that each of the requirements of ss.186, 187 and 188 as are relevant to this application for approval have been met.

[3] The Maritime Union of Australia being a bargaining representative for the Agreement has given notice under s.183 of the Act that it wants the Agreement to cover it. In accordance with s.201(2) and based on the statutory declaration provided by the organisation, I note that the Agreement covers the organisation.

[4] The Agreement was approved on 27 April 2015 and, in accordance with s.54, will operate from 4 May 2015. The nominal expiry date of the Agreement is 31 December 2018.
